Building codes and regulations are essential frameworks that guarantee safety, structural integrity, and public health in any development project. For building contractors, understanding these codes isn't just a authorized obligation but additionally a means to guard their purchasers and their own reputations. These laws can differ broadly relying on the jurisdiction, so it's crucial for contractors to stay updated on native, state, and federal necessities.


Local building departments often administer constructing codes. These codes dictate pointers on quite so much of construction elements, such as electrical methods, plumbing, zoning, and hearth safety. Each of those areas has distinct necessities that should be adhered to, and any deviation can result in costly fines or even the requirement to redo work. Knowledge of native zoning laws can be vital, as these dictate land use and the nature of constructions that can be in-built particular areas.

The International Building Code (IBC) is usually the foundational doc for many U.S. states. It covers a broad spectrum of construction-related subjects from accessibility to power effectivity. Adhering to the IBC not solely ensures compliance but also promotes best practices in construction. Contractors ought to always reference the most recent model of the IBC during project planning, as updates may include significant adjustments.


Understanding fireplace codes is particularly important for contractors involved in commercial construction. The National Fire Protection Association (NFPA) offers extensive guidelines for hearth safety. This consists of specifications for fire alarm systems, sprinkler techniques, and emergency exits. Practicing adherence to fireside codes can imply the difference between life and demise in emergency situations.

Accessibility laws, notably the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), demand consideration as properly. These rules are supposed to make certain that public buildings are usable by everyone, including those with disabilities. Contractors must pay attention to requirements related to wheelchair ramps, accessible restrooms, and signage. Violating ADA pointers can lead to lawsuits, fines, and unfavorable publicity.


Environmental regulations are more and more turning into a focus point in construction as sustainability features traction. Rules concerning waste administration, recycling, and the usage of eco-friendly materials are important for contemporary contractors. Compliance not only attracts eco-conscious clients but also contributes to the general well-being of the group.


Permits are a fundamental side of any development project governed by constructing codes. Before commencing work, a contractor should obtain the necessary permits from native authorities. This step demonstrates compliance with applicable laws and ensures that inspections could be conducted all through the project's period. Failure to secure the proper permits can lead to significant setbacks.

Inspections are another key element of the constructing course of. Regular inspections make certain that the construction adheres to established codes. They can occur at numerous phases, from basis laying to ultimate touches. Understanding when to count on inspections helps contractors schedule their work effectively, avoiding delays that could derail a project timeline.


Liability and insurance issues are also intertwined with constructing codes. Failure to adjust to laws can outcome in accidents, potential lawsuits, and hefty fines. Contractors ought to safe insurance that covers not solely basic legal responsibility but also specific factors related to building code compliance. This offers a layer of protection against unforeseen incidents.


Keeping comprehensive records of compliance with building codes may also be beneficial in case of disputes. Proper documentation can provide evidence of adherence to laws, which may safeguard contractors from liability issues. Regular audits of compliance information can even help establish areas for enchancment.

Performance-based building codes have gotten extra common, focusing not solely on compliance with specific supplies and strategies but also on the tip end result. Rather than dictating the way to obtain safety, these codes emphasize the outcomes, permitting contractors more flexibility. Understanding this shift can higher prepare contractors for future initiatives the place innovation meets safety laws.

How can I discover the building codes relevant to my project?


To find related building codes in your project, consult your local constructing department or municipal workplace. Many jurisdictions publish their codes online. Additionally, skilled organizations and trade associations usually provide sources for understanding these regulations.
